STUDIO RULES
All equipment is used at the student’s own risk.
Using poles or lyra equipment without an instructor present is strictly prohibited.
Students are liable for any damage caused to studio property or equipment.
Students are to take care of all equipment used during classes.
For your safety and to prevent damage to equipment, no jewellery is allowed.
Notify the instructor of any injuries or strains at the start of each class and immediately if any arise during the session.
Consult a doctor before attending classes if you have any medical concerns or conditions.
Students must check the stability and safety of equipment before class begins. Seek assistance from an instructor if unsure.
Participation in the class warm-up and cool down is compulsory.
Students arriving late must ensure they complete their own warm-up before joining.
Students arriving more than 15 minutes late will not be allowed to join the class.
Be mindful of your surroundings, objects, and other students during class.
No alcohol consumption before or during class.
Eating and chewing gum are not permitted during class.
Stop immediately if you feel unwell, fatigued, or sustain an injury during class.
Pole Dance Cape Town is not responsible for the loss or theft of personal belongings. Students are encouraged to keep valuables with them at all times.
Students are expected to maintain respectful conduct toward instructors and fellow participants.
Disruptive or inappropriate behaviour may result in removal from the class or termination of the contract without a refund.
